Hi, I have built cases if the customer is willing to pay for one, but it sure does add heaps to the cost. I could build another CBG in the time it takes and the materials neaded to make a lined and covered case.

My approach for CBG's I sell is to throw in a calico type string pull bag (my good wife knocked up a couple of dozen) and let the customer organise a case or gig bag if they want one. My CBG's are too deep for a standard electric guitar hard case, and for me cases are too bulky. I use a soft gig bag meant for a bass guitar. I take mine everywhere when traveling, and often can't spare the extra space a case would take up in the car.

Big 5 sells those, as does Walmart, but beware, some are flimsy, I have used a few good rifle cases, but those could be pricey? also make sure you’re using a dense foam, that soft egg carton stuff won’t do much in the way of an impact, found that out the hard way? 

For the cost I can buy a used guitar case. I look for ones without formed interiors. By the time I figure in the cost of latches, hinges and the wood it's only slightly cheaper than what I can pick up a used one for.
